### What Is BlockDAG? The Hybrid Tech Driving Its Ambitions

BlockDAG isn’t just another blockchain copycat. It blends traditional blockchain principles with DAG technology, creating a hybrid Layer-1 network inspired by Bitcoin’s PoW security but upgraded for modern demands.

In a standard blockchain, transactions form a single linear chain—blocks are added one at a time, creating bottlenecks. BlockDAG uses a Directed Acyclic Graph where multiple blocks can be confirmed in parallel. This allows for far higher throughput without sacrificing the security of PoW consensus.

Key advantages include:
- **Scalability**: Claims of thousands of transactions per second (TPS) at launch, with potential to scale higher—dwarfing Bitcoin’s ~7 TPS or even many high-speed chains. Parallel processing minimizes congestion.
- **Security & Decentralization**: PoW (Bitcoin-style) ensures censorship resistance and attack resistance, while the hybrid model keeps the network truly distributed.
- **EVM Compatibility**: Developers can easily port Ethereum dApps, smart contracts, and tools, accelerating ecosystem growth.
- **Accessible Mining**: A standout feature is mobile mining via the X1 app (already with millions of users). No expensive ASICs required for basic participation—smartphones suffice, democratizing rewards. Physical miners (X10/X30/X100) are also shipping.

Compared to pure blockchains, BlockDAG’s multi-dimensional structure (as shown below) enables simultaneous block creation and faster confirmations (~2 seconds) at ultra-low fees.

This tech positions BDAG for real-world use in DeFi, supply chains, payments, and beyond—provided adoption follows.

### The Presale Journey and “Aftersale” Thinking: From Fundraising to Value Creation

BlockDAG’s presale was epic: starting December 25, 2023, at $0.0001, it ran through dozens of batches, ultimately raising $452 million against a $600 million hard cap before closing in early February 2026. Over 300,000 holders and millions of mobile miners joined.

The “aftersale” phase—post-presale strategy—reflects deliberate thinking. The team designed the extended presale to maximize funding and community building without rushing to market. Once the cap was approached (though not fully hit), the shift was clear: move from aggressive marketing to “value marketing.”

Post-presale plans emphasize:
- Ecosystem development: Super App launch (mining + wallet + trading) in April 2026, staking (already live), NFT marketplace, lending, oracles, and third-party dApps by June.
- Transparent vesting: 40% unlock at TGE, 60% over three months to curb dumps.
- Developer focus: Tools, docs, low-code smart contract builders, and partnerships.
- Treasury management: Unsold coins remain controlled and on-chain visible for ongoing incentives.

This aftersale mindset shows maturity—many projects fizzle after raising funds, but BlockDAG appears committed to long-term utility over short-term hype. The six-month presale-to-mainnet window (a bold timeline) underscores confidence in delivery.
